Latest Patents

Kim M Noone holds a patent for a vital signs monitor designed for controlling power-adjustable examination tables. This invention addresses the critical need for efficient data gathering in clinical settings. The device combines medical examination tables, dental chairs, and vital signs monitors, which feature integrated hardware and software. This integration enables seamless data collection and communication, enhancing the ease of use for clinicians and ultimately improving patient care.
